中文摘要: 针对属性权重未知、属性值为犹豫模糊集的多属性决策问题,本文提出一种基于前景理论和粗糙集的多属性决策方法,充分考虑了决策者心理风险因素对决策结果的影响.首先,以正、负理想点作为参考点计算各属性下的前景价值函数,定义新的综合前景值,并根据给定的阈值得到判断矩阵;然后,根据判断矩阵进行属性约简,确定属性权重;最后,计算各备选方案的加权综合前景值,利用TOPSIS方法对备选方案进行排序,并通过算例证实该方法的可行性和有效性.
Abstract:For the multi-attribute decision making problem with attribute weights being unknown and attribute values being hesitant fuzzy sets, this study proposes a multi-attribute decision making method based on prospect theory and rough set, which fully considers the influence of decision makers' psychological risk factors on decision results. Firstly, the positive and negative ideal points are used as reference points to calculate the prospect value function under each attribute and to define a new comprehensive prospect value, and a discernibility matrix is obtained according to the given threshold. Then, according to the discernibility matrix, attribute reduction is performed to determine the attribute weight. Finally, the weighted comprehensive prospect value of each alternative is calculated, and the TOPSIS method is used to rank all the alternatives. An example is given to illustrate the feasibility and effectiveness of the proposed method.
